        8Tweekums

        Good claustrophobic sci-fi

        As this film opens a woman wakes in an airtight medical cryogenic chamber. She has no idea who she is or how she got there... or even where 'there' is. The unit is controlled by an artificial intelligence called MILO; this informs her that due to an unspecified problem she is rapidly running out of oxygen. If she is to survive she will have to recover enough of her memories to learn about the situation she is in... and avoid some of MILO's attempts to make her little remaining time more comfortable.

        Going into this film I'd say the less you know the better; there are some good twists and it is best one learns facts at the same time as our protagonist. The film is, apart from a few brief flashbacks, set almost entirely within the cramped pod; this gives an impressively claustrophobic feel to proceedings. The more we learn the greater the sense of hopelessness. Mélanie Laurent does a really fine job as our protagonist; you can feel both her anguish, fear and occasional optimism as situations change. The inside of the pod is well designed; large enough for some movement but not enough for full movement. Overall a solid film for sci-fi fans who don't demand lots of action.

        These comments are based on watching the film in French with English subtitles.

        • Trivia
          Anne Hathaway was originally attached to the project. She later dropped out and was replaced by Noomi Rapace. After the project was put into turnaround, Mélanie Laurent was cast in the lead role when Alexandre Aja came on board.
        • Goofs
          The brief moment of zero gravity implies that rotation for the single capsule can be stopped. However, a subsequent view indicated that the entire structure rotates, making it implausible that a single capsule could achieve zero gravity.
